Re: error code 80070490
Originally Posted by Dirizhor
Temporary Solution:
Reset the following services in this order:
1. BITS (Background Intelligent Transfer Service)
2. Cryptographic Services - Windows Update)
then restart your system
Permanent Solution:
If you have a lot of time on your hands, turn on your computer and boot to Vista. Insert your original Vista DVD, then select "Upgrade" from the list, and let the program do the rest. It seems that this has been the only really successful way of getting the Windows Update to work again. A number of people have done this method and say it works. You may have to reinstall sound drivers once it is done.
